Standard engine?

 

They do run pig rich from cold and 10 doesn't sound too far off from memory.  Are you letting the AEM warm up for a couple of minutes before cranking it over, as it takes time for the O2 heater to get it up to temp?

stock engine apart from forged low comp 8:5:1 pistons

obd1 dizzy no cat

I pin tested all the sensors from the ecu connector and found a few issues (grounds mainly)

as well as checking the fuel pressure and finding it

6psi down, a new regulator sorted that, and it no runs a treat

about 11.2 to 11.5 on start up

also ticks over a lot better and revs nicely,
